How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Iron Gate?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Iron Gate Studio Apartments | $703 | $690 | $710 |
| Iron Gate 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,409 | $700 | $2,510 |
Iron Gate 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,734 | $765 | $3,685 |
| Iron Gate 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,037 | $1,047 | $3,825 |
| Iron Gate 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,890 | $1,790 | $1,940 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 2 Bedroom Iron Gate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Iron Gate with 2 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 2 Bedroom in Iron Gate is at Hillcrest Manor Apartments listed at $765.
How much is the average rent for a 2 Bedroom Iron Gate Apartment?
The average rent for a 2 Bedroom Apartment in Iron Gate is $1,734.
What is the largest available 2 Bedroom Iron Gate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Iron Gate is a 1,178 square feet unit starting from $1,650 at Glade Creek (I).
What is the average size for Iron Gate 2 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 2 Bedroom rental in Iron Gate is currently 1,087 sq ft.
